New Orleans Saints quarterback Drew Brees is always open about his admiration of all U.S. Military, both past and present.

Last year at Sean Payton's Black & Gold Gala, Brees and his wife Brittany were introduced to the K9s for Warriors program.

The program is designed to pair up service K9s with those who served in the military post 9/11 and are suffering from PTSD (Post-traumatic Stress Disability), military sexual trauma, or traumatic brain injury.

K9s who are coupled with Warriors help empower the veteran in his or her return to civilian life and independence.

The Brees' sponsored a German Shepard mix. Fittingly, the dog is named "Brees".

"Brees" joins Air Force veteran April Sandlin, who currently suffers from PTSD.


In a statement released by Sandlin through K9s for Warriors, she expressed the benefit of having "Brees".

"I can feel a difference in my life. I am very thankful for K9s For Warriors and that Drew Brees was so kind to sponsor my dog. Many things in combat cannot be unseen or unheard. I can't forget those things, but my dog helps me focus on something different -- our bond."
